The Old Jail Museum dates back to 1871 and gives you a fascinating look inside one of the town’s most historic buildings. Take a guided tour through the original cells, hear the stories of the people who were once held here, and learn about some of the darker chapters of Jim Thorpe’s past.
And then there’s the infamous handprint on the wall… 👋 It’s said to have been left by a prisoner and has survived all attempts to remove it.
